MOSS CLEANING PETERBOROUGH
Naturally occurring in Peterborough, especially in shady and damp spots, moss is a flowerless plant that develops thick clumps of stems as it spreads over surfaces. It spreads by way of spores which drop onto nearby surfaces to grow very quickly. Untreated patches of moss on your roof can cause pitting to the surfaces of slate, clay and cement tiles, and in the process damage their weatherproofing layer. Water could leak into your property in Peterborough if this pitting or scarring develops into fractures or holes and compromise the weatherproofing and waterproofing of your roof.
SOFT WASHING PETERBOROUGH
Moss removal from your roof is often performed by hand by professional cleaning services in Peterborough. This method is kind to the roof and ensures that the waste materials can be readily collected as the cleaning proceeds. A solution is applied to clean the remaining roof areas after the moss has been cleared. After the cleaning solution dries, a treatment is applied to eradicate any remaining moss spores on the roof tiles. This treatment, which uses biocide, also combats algae and lichens that flourish in damp, shady environments. Commonly known in the trade as 'soft washing', this entire process can also refer to cleaning the roof without removing moss or other build-up prior to the cleaning.

If you were to leave a roof without having a suitable biocide spray you could notice a moss re-growing in just a few short months. If you do go ahead with this, a trustworthy Peterborough roof cleaning service will recommend a follow-up treatment every 24-36 months, to keep your roof in the best condition possible and free from moss, although treating it should guarantee it is clear for at least 3 to 4 years.
When the roof cleaning process has been completed, a first rate roof cleaning specialist in Peterborough will also clear your guttering system of any loose debris, to stop future blockages and allow the free flow of rainwater into your downpipes.
PRESSURE WASHING TO CLEAN YOUR ROOF IN PETERBOROUGH
If your roof or tiles have been in any way damaged, or your dwelling in Peterborough is older, a professional roof cleaning company will generally advise against jet washing. This is due to the fact that a high pressure jet of water can easily penetrate the tiles, damage the water-resistant membrane and allow water to enter your house causing damage. While this might be the fastest way to find whether your roof leaks, it isn't wise to attempt this without professional expertise.
The employment of a pressure washing machine, and the highly powerful stream of water that it sends out, can inflict serious damage on other parts of your roofing system, especially guttering, flashings, soffits, fascias and pointing. At a minimum, using a DIY power washer on your property's roof could affect the watertight finish on your tiles and reduce their natural lifespan.
After looking at the downsides of jet washing your roof, the time has come to realise that there are instances when it may be possible. When a roof cleaning company in Peterborough has completed an inspection of your roof, and established the extent of the work involved, the most effective cleaning strategy can be agreed on. If it is felt that jet washing your tiles will not have a negative impact, they might decide that this is the most cost-effective and tenable option for your roof cleaning assignment.

The bog standard devices that many property owners use are not up to the standard of the pressure washers that are used by roof cleaning companies in Peterborough, which have advanced features like adjustable pressures for water flow that can be altered to cater to certain conditions and situations. This makes certain that while effectively cleaning the area, your roof or tiles suffer no damage or harm whatsoever. To keep your roof in good shape for some time to come, as with hand cleaning, there will be a separate biocide treatment to prevent further re-growth of algae and moss.

STEAM CLEANING YOUR ROOF IN PETERBOROUGH
Steam cleaning is the greenest solution a roof cleaning service can offer. Any algae, lichens and moss are killed off by the high temperature steam, and no chemicals or harsh cleaning products are employed during the process. Eco-friendly and sustainable biocides are now being produced which do not damage the environment, and these have become increasingly popular with enlightened and responsible property owners. Green anti-fungal treatments like Bioxide, that are environmentally safe, non-toxic and can be used on any kind of surface after steam cleaning, are attracting considerable interest in the steam cleaning sector.
When compared with pressure washing, steam cleaning uses a far reduced pressure. The additional benefit of this is that there is less likelihood of damaging your roof. The downside to a steam clean is that it is the most expensive option with regards to cleaning your roof.

Asbestos Roof Cleaning
In the past widely used in construction materials due to its fire-resisting qualities, asbestos is a naturally occurring mineral. While once considered safe, asbestos now presents a significant health hazard when inhaled. Asbestosis, lung cancer and mesothelioma are just some of the severe health issues linked to inhaling asbestos fibres.
Crucially, if your property has got a roof made of asbestos, you must ensure its safe management. The dangers of cleaning an asbestos roof yourself are too great to consider - expert help is vital. Pressure washing, or similar techniques that disturb asbestos fibres, can release them into the air, creating a serious health risk for you and those around you.

Fortunately, there are safer alternatives when it comes to managing asbestos roofing:
- Leave it Undisturbed: While regular monitoring is crucial for all asbestos roofs in TOWN, leaving undamaged ones undisturbed can often be the safest alternative. This is particularly true if they aren't currently causing any concerns.
- Softwashing: Eliminating algae, moss and other organic roof invaders? This approach uses a low-pressure biocide treatment application. By reducing the disruption of asbestos fibres, this solution offers a safer solution. For safe softwashing of an asbestos roof, entrust the task to a qualified professional with the correct training and equipment.
- Encapsulation: Want an answer to airborne asbestos issues? Encapsulation! This procedure involves coating the asbestos roof with a sealant that binds together the fibres, keeping them safely secured. Encapsulation is a long-term solution but requires professional application and recurring maintenance.
- Asbestos Roof Replacement: For an asbestos roof with severe damage, or if you're planning major refurbishments anyway, complete replacement might be the most practical solution. Replacing an asbestos roof is not a DIY undertaking! This complex job requires a licensed asbestos removal contractor.
- Vegetation Control: Algae, moss, lichen, and other organic growth trapping moisture could potentially accelerate the deterioration of asbestos. Employing procedures that minimise the chance of disturbing the dangerous fibres, a competent professional can remove this growth safely.
By putting safety first and foremost and adhering to best practices can minimise the associated risks of exposure to asbestos, despite the particular difficulties presented by asbestos roofs in terms of maintenance and cleaning. Asbestos roofs require a mindful and cautious approach. Every action, from maintenance tasks to routine cleaning, should be undertaken with a clear understanding of the possible threats. To guarantee the safe management of asbestos roofs and safeguard their health and well-being, home and property owners should adhere to safety guidelines and promptly seek professional assistance when necessary..... Solar Panel Cleaning
To maintain system efficiency, professional solar panel cleaning is essential. Bird droppings, dust and debris can build up on the panels, reducing their effectiveness by blocking sunlight. Maximising your investment, regular professional cleaning ensures that your solar panels receive the most sunlight. This process boosts the performance of your solar energy system substantially.

For solar panel cleaning, hiring a professional service is convenient and straightforward. Avoiding abrasive materials or high-pressure water that could harm the panels, cleaning operatives use soft brushes or sponges with soapy water to lightly scrub the surface. To protect against thermal shock, they usually clean the solar panels early in the morning or late in the evening when they're cool.
The efficiency of your solar panels is boosted, and their lifespan extended, through routine professional maintenance like cleaning. Cleaning should be scheduled at least twice annually, or more often if you reside in a particularly dusty area. To maximise energy savings and ensure optimal performance, clean solar panels contribute to a more sustainable environment. Long-lasting benefits are provided for your solar panel system by investing in specialist cleaning services. (Tags: Solar Panel Cleaning)

Roof Cleaning Tips
Ensuring your roof is clean is essential to keeping your home looking good and preventing long-term damage. Over time, moss, algae, and debris can build up on the roof, which not only makes it look untidy but can also cause problems. Regular cleaning can help avoid costly repairs and extend the life of your roof.
One of the simplest ways to clean your roof is by removing loose debris, such as leaves and twigs, with a broom or leaf blower. It's important to avoid using metal tools as these can damage roof tiles. Always work carefully and start from the top, working your way down to avoid pushing debris under the tiles.

You can remove moss and algae by applying a specialist roof cleaner or a water and bleach solution. Use a sprayer to apply the mixture, letting it sit for 20-30 minutes before scrubbing with a soft brush. Rinse the roof thoroughly with clean water to eliminate any leftover residue.
Cleaning your roof with pressure washing can be effective, but it requires caution. High pressure can damage roof tiles or drive water underneath them, resulting in leaks. If you're not confident, it's a good idea to hire a professional to manage the cleaning safely.
Prioritise safety when cleaning your roof. Use a sturdy ladder, wear non-slip shoes, and consider using a harness if working on a steep roof. If the job seems too risky, it's advisable to leave it to professionals with the necessary equipment and experience.
Bird Deterrents
Installing bird deterrents on your roof can be a good way to keep it clean and free from bird droppings. Birds often perch and nest on roofs, leading to droppings that can stain roof surfaces and block gutters. Setting up deterrents like spikes, nets or reflective objects can prevent birds from landing and creating a mess.

Because of their humane design and ease of installation, bird spikes are one of the most popular options. These spikes create an uneven surface that deters birds from landing, prompting them to find another spot. Particularly useful for bigger areas, netting serves as a barrier that prevents birds from accessing certain parts of the roof.
Effective options also include reflective materials such as shiny tape or discs. Perceived as a predator or threat, the movement and reflection usually scares off the birds. Keeping your roof cleaner, such deterrents also reduce the need for regular upkeep and possible repairs caused by bird damage when installed.
